Terror attack at Federal College of Education Kano
Official figures indicate that 15 people have been killed and another 37 injured in a terror attack in Kano, Northern Nigeria. Police said the dead included two suicide bombers, while most of the injured were students and lecturers.
An explosion followed by sporadic gun shots is believed to have occurred around 2pm at the Federal College of Education, Kano.
Kano State's Police Commissioner - Mr Aderinle Shinaba, said an insurgent carrying an AK47 rifle and explosives was shot and the explosive went off and killed him.President Goodluck Ebele Jonathan commiserated "with citizens and residents of Kano State on the loss of lives sustained today during the attack by terrorists," and sent "sympathies and best wishes for a speedy recovery" to "all those who suffered injuries in the dastardly attack."
